Tomatillo

Tomatillo or husk-tomato (physalis Philadelphica) is in the same family as tomato but different genus. It is commonly cultivated in Mexico and Guatemala. The ripe fruit is like green tomato. We like tomatillo in cold soup, salsa, and sometimes fry it like fried green tomatoes.

Interesting facts about tomatilo (from http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tomatillo):
- Other parts of the plant, besides fruit, are toxic and should not be eaten.
-  The plant is highly self-incompatible, two or more plants are needed to pollinate properly.
